Half-Way Covenant

A form of partial church membership created by New England Puritans in 1662, allowing for the baptism and a form of limited membership for individuals not yet converted.

Puritan Churches

Religious institutions established by the Puritans, who were a group of English Protestants seeking to "purify" the Church of England from its Catholic practices in the 16th and 17th centuries.
